Thailand is not only famous for its vibrant cities like Bangkok, Chiang Mai, and Chiang Rai, but also known as a true paradise of islands. With crystal-clear turquoise water, soft white sand, and stunning natural scenery, the beaches here can easily capture anyone’s heart.
Known as “the jewel of Asia”, Koh Phi Phi is one of the most beautiful islands in the world. The emerald-green sea, dramatic limestone cliffs, and transparent water make it a perfect tropical getaway.
Maya Bay, featured in the movie ‘’The Beach’’ starring Leonardo DiCaprio, has made Koh Phi Phi a dream destination for travelers around the globe. Here, you can go snorkeling among coral reefs, relax on white sandy beaches, or watch a breathtaking sunset in peaceful surroundings.
The largest island in Thailand, Phuket is located in the southwest and is often called “the paradise island”. It offers a perfect mix of sea, forest, and mountains. Visitors can enjoy many fun activities such as diving, surfing, parasailing, fishing, or speedboat tours—or simply sunbathe and enjoy the fresh air.
Phuket is also famous for its diverse cuisine, Muay Thai shows, and the colorful Simon Cabaret performance. When night falls, the beaches come alive with bars, restaurants, and night markets—creating a lively yet relaxed atmosphere.
Located near Phuket, Krabi attracts visitors with its giant limestone cliffs, lush rainforests, and crystal-clear blue water. The landscape remains largely untouched, making it an ideal place to unwind, listen to the sound of nature, and enjoy the peace of the sea and forest.
Koh Samui offers a different kind of charm—with its lively nightlife and luxury beachfront resorts. You can take a walk along the beach, enjoy fresh seafood, or simply watch the romantic sunset in a calm and relaxing setting.
Best Time to Visit:
- Phuket, Krabi, Koh Phi Phi (West Coast – Andaman Sea)
Ideal time: November to April
Weather: Dry, sunny, and calm seas—perfect for swimming, snorkeling, and island-hopping. - Koh Samui, Koh Phangan, Koh Tao (East Coast – Gulf of Thailand)
Best time: February to August
Weather: Warm, with little rain and clear water—great for beach holidays and sea parties.
